First, add color(red)(18) to each side of the equation to isolate the x term while keeping the equation balanced:
32x^2 - 18 + color(red)(18) = 0 + color(red)(18)
32x^2 - 0 = 18
32x^2 = 18
Next, divide each side of the equation by color(red)(32) to isolate the x^2 term while keeping the equation balanced:
(32x^2)/color(red)(32) = 18/color(red)(32)
(color(red)(cancel(color(black)(32)))x^2)/cancel(color(red)(32)) = (2 xx 9)/color(red)(2 xx 16)
x^2 = (color(red)(cancel(color(black)(2))) xx 9)/color(red)(color(black)(cancel(color(red)(2))) xx 16)
x^2 = 9/16
Now, take the square root of each side of the equation to solve for x while keeping the equation balanced. Remember, taking the square root of a number produces a negative and positive result:
sqrt(x^2) = sqrt(9/16)
x = sqrt(9)/sqrt(16)
x = +-3/4
